What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, also called an automotive locksmith, is a customized professional trained to deal with all kinds of issues connected to vehicle locks and keys. These experts can help with a series of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miths are geared up with the tools and knowledge to manage modern car security systems, consisting of those with sophisticated inn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.

Q: How much does a car locksmith normally c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can differ based on the particular job, the make and design of your car, and the location. Normally, unlocking a car can vary from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a brand-new key can c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complicated tasks like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a new key without the original?A: Yes, an expert car locksmith can make a new key even if you don't have the initial. Nevertheless, this procedure may need additional time and tools, and it can be more costly than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miths legal?A: Yes, car locksmiths are legal, but they need to be accredited and bonded in a lot of states. They are likewise required to validate the identity of the vehicle owner to prevent theft or unauthorized gain access to.

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to show up?A: The action time can vary. In urban areas, it may take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ote locations, the wait time can be longer. Many locksmith professionals use 24/7 emergency situation services.

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miths who are trained in modern automotive technology can program transponder keys. This includes syncing the key's special code with your car's onboard computer system.

Q: Do car locksmith professionals use mobile services?A: Yes, lots of car locksmiths provide mobile services, enabling them to come to your place, whether it's your home, office, or the side of the road.

Car locksmiths use a variety of tools and technologies to perform their services:
Lock Picks and Decoders: For conventional lockout assistance and lock adjustment.Key Cutting Machines: To duplicate keys properly.Transponder Key Programmers: To program transponder keys to your car's specific code.Diagnostic Scanners: To identify issues with your car's electronic systems.Drilling Equipment: For scenarios where locks are significantly harmed and need to be drilled out.
